    Centered around outer east Portland’s Glenfair, Centennial, and Rockwood, 97233 offers a down-to-earth, community-minded vibe with easy transit and room to breathe. The MAX Blue Line runs along Burnside with stops at 148th, 162nd, 172nd, and 181st, and the FX2-Division bus speeds you to inner neighborhoods; quick access to I-84 and I-205 helps commuters. Daily conveniences are close by—Grocery Outlet and international markets, coffee stands like Dutch Bros and Black Rock, local taquerias, pho shops, and East African eateries—plus nearby shopping at Gresham Station and Mall 205, fitness centers, and the Rockwood Market Hall food incubators. Green spaces are a highlight, from Parklane and Glenfair parks to trails at Powell Butte and the Gresham-Fairview Trail, with Mount Hood views on clear days; families and pets find plenty of playfields and off-leash options. In the past few months, Zillow market trends show a median asking rent around $1,650, with most listings roughly $1,200 to $2,200, making it one of Portland’s more budget-friendly areas.
